Specifying the B1 Level: What Does "Intermediate" Mean?
The CEFR divides language proficiency into six levels, varying from A1 (Beginner) to C2 (Mastery). At the [B1 Prüfung Ohne Kurs](https://codimd.communecter.org/xDHD25dBQSaTDsst8DQ1oA/) level, a learner is no longer simply reciting remembered expressions; they are beginning to navigate the language with a degree of independence.

A person at the B1 level can typically:
Understand the main points of clear, basic input on familiar matters frequently experienced in work, school, and leisure.Deal with many circumstances likely to develop while taking a trip in a location where the language is spoken.Produce easy linked text on topics that are familiar or of personal interest.Explain experiences, events, dreams, hopes, and aspirations, and briefly provide factors and explanations for viewpoints and plans.Table 1: CEFR Proficiency OverviewLevelClassificationDescriptionA1 - A2Fundamental UserCan interact in easy, everyday tasks.B1 - B2Independent UserCan navigate most situations and express perspectives.C1 - C2Proficient UserCan understand intricate texts and speak fluently.Why Pursue a B1 Certificate?
The B1 certificate is more than just a notepad; it is a gateway to several worldwide opportunities. Organizations, federal governments, and universities worldwide recognize this level as proof that an individual can function in a native-speaking environment without constant support.
1. Citizenship and Residency
In many countries, a B1 certificate is a legal requirement for naturalization or permanent residency. For instance, the UK Home Office requires a [B1 Prüfung Kosten](https://notes.io/ecu6X) English certificate (such as SELT) for citizenship applications. Similarly, Germany needs a B1 level in German (Deutsch-Test für Zuwanderer) for those looking for to become people.
2. Work Opportunities
While high-level executive functions may need C1 efficiency, numerous trade tasks, hospitality functions, and administrative positions accept B1-level candidates. It shows that the worker can follow guidelines, interact with customers, and get involved in standard office meetings.
3. Vocational Training and Education
Numerous professional colleges and preparatory courses for universities (Studienkolleg) require a B1 certificate as an entry threshold. It makes sure the trainee can follow lectures and participate in classroom conversations.
The Components of a B1 Exam
While different companies (like Cambridge, Goethe-Institut, DELF, or IELTS) have slightly different formats, most B1 examinations are divided into 4 core modules.
The Reading Module
Prospects are needed to read numerous texts, such as blog posts, newspaper articles, ads, and main guidelines. They should identify both basic styles and specific details.
Period: Approximately 65-- 90 minutes.Job Types: Multiple option, matching, and true/false.The Listening Module
This section checks the ability to comprehend spoken language in different contexts, such as an announcement at a train station, a radio interview, or a casual conversation between good friends.
Period: Approximately 30-- 40 minutes.Secret Challenge: Understanding different accents and filtering background noise.The Writing Module
The [Sprachzertifikat B1 Deutsch](https://codimd.communecter.org/ZzAUhZoXSe63HJvyWqOCrA/) writing examination generally consists of two or three jobs. Prospects may be asked to compose an individual email to a pal or a more formal letter/response to an online forum post.
Focus: Cohesion, grammar precision, and suitable vocabulary.Word Count: Usually in between 80 and 150 words per job.The Speaking Module
This is frequently thought about the most stressful part. Candidates generally perform this in sets or individually with an inspector.
Jobs: A short discussion on a familiar subject, a conversation with a partner to plan an occasion, and a quick interview about personal interests.Examination: Fluency, pronunciation, and the capability to communicate.Popular B1 Certification Exams by Language

Typically, it takes roughly 350 to 500 assisted discovering hours to reach B1 from an overall novice start. This differs based on the learner's previous experience and the intensity of study.
Does a B1 certificate end?
Most B1 certificates (like the Goethe-[Zertifikat Telc B1](https://posteezy.com/watch-out-what-b1-exam-certificate-taking-over-and-what-you-can-do-about-it-0) or DELF) do not have a formal expiration date. Nevertheless, for migration functions, lots of federal governments need the certificate to be no older than two to 5 years.

Can I take the modules separately?
This depends upon the test provider. For example, the Goethe B1 German exam allows candidates to take Reading, Writing, Listening, and Speaking as 4 independent modules. If a prospect stops working one, they only require to retake that particular part.
What is the passing score?
Generally, a rating of 60% throughout all modules is needed to pass. Some tests need a minimum score in each module to be granted the general certificate.
